**Mgmt Meeting Minutes — Retiring the Brightline Range**

Quick recap for sales leads at Fenholt Supplies: we agreed to retire the Brightline fixture range by year-end. Remaining stock moves to clearance pricing next month, and accounts on standing orders get migrated to the Lumetta range. Trade-in incentives were approved in principle. The confidential note on next steps sits just below.

board note of bajof-bajeg: The pricing group signed off on a budget of $13.4 million for Project Sildor. The renewal with Lamixek Holdings closes at $48.9 million a year, 49 percent above the last contract.

Handover — Vexler auth team, weekly sync. Password reset revamp on Driftgate is ~80% done. Token issuance moved to the new Embercode service; old SMS path is dead, don't revive it. Rate limiting now per-account, not per-IP. Remaining work: expiry edge cases and the localization strings for the reset email. Marit owns QA from Thursday. Deploy only from the hardened pipeline. The staging instance must run with the following config values.

config for kafof-bawef:
holath:
  log_level: debug
  metrics_host: metrics.holath.qorvelsys.internal
  pin: 2191
  pool_size: 32

## Onboarding: The Great Calendar Sync Conflict

Welcome! You'll hear about "the double-booking bug" a lot. Short version: Plumline's sync engine used to merge events from both the Harborview and Tinbell calendars without a tiebreaker, so edits ping-ponged forever. The fix lives in `sync.env`: `PLUMLINE_CONFLICT_POLICY=newest_wins` and `PLUMLINE_SYNC_WINDOW_DAYS=14`. Don't change those without talking to the platform crew. The sync worker also needs its calendar bridge credential, set on the following line.

env line for bahip-baguf: LEDGER_TOKEN8=27066bbf